Xbattery raises $2.3 million to fuel battery innovation

Share via:



Hyderabad-based deeptech startup Xbattery has raised $2.3 million in a funding round led by the Bipin Patel Family Office, with participation from Jhaveri Credits.

The company will use the fresh capital to upgrade its research and development (R&D) facilities and expand its engineering and production teams.

“We need to purchase large equipment for our R&D. We are also upgrading our R&D lab and hiring more R&D engineers,” said Satish Reddy, cofounder of Xbattery, in an interaction with ET.
